HTML <img src> 不会加载我的图片
Posted
技术标签:
【中文标题】HTML <img src> 不会加载我的图片【英文标题】:HTML <img src> wont load my images 【发布时间】:2013-11-30 18:32:19 【问题描述】:我对此感到茫然,我用 jquery 创建了我的网站的移动版本,但我的图像拒绝加载 img src 标签。
<img src="images/me.jpg" >
我尝试使用直接从我的网站加载我的图像,但他们也拒绝加载,并将图像移动到与网页相同的目录,但仍然没有。我只是得到一个宽度和高度大小的框,中间有一个替代文本和一个图像图标。
我只是不明白它有什么问题。
提前致谢。
【问题讨论】:
您确定me.jpg
图像位于images
目录中,并且网络服务器有权访问该目录并且已配置为从中提供图像吗?
图像肯定在正确的目录中。我尝试在本地而不是在线修复它,但我仍然遇到同样的问题
如果您尝试从错误的目录加载它们,您应该收到404 not found
错误,或者如果您的应用程序没有访问该目录的权限,您应该收到403 unauthorized
。检查您的控制台是否有错误。
然后检查您的 html - 您确定它在正确的目录中吗?您是否已保存更改?您是否使用了可能会导致实际路径混淆的服务器端包含或类似内容?
你可以尝试 2 件事 1:在 src 中输入图像的完整路径 2:保存图像,在 Photoshop 中打开并再次保存为 JPG.. 并尝试...
【参考方案1】:
尝试使用完整路径:
<img src="http://www.yourdomain.com/images/me.jpg" width="200" height="267" alt="me">
出于测试目的,只需打开http://www.yourdomain.com/images/me.jpg,您应该会看到图像。如果它不起作用,那么您的 html/jquery 一定存在兼容性问题。只需发布您的 html 文件的其余部分并告诉我们您正在使用的 jquery 插件...
【讨论】:
试试这个...如果您的 index.html 或 index.php 在文件夹 /yourdomain 中并且您的图像包含在 /yourdomain/image 中,请修改 src="./image//images/me.jpg
【参考方案2】:
我的图像实际上已损坏或无法正常工作,因为我无法在 Photoshop 中打开它们,我不得不替换这些图像。
【讨论】:
【参考方案3】:我也遇到了同样的问题。它是文件名中的大写字母。有些图片正在加载,有些则没有。有些图片有大写的.JPG
文件扩展名,有些有小写的.jpg
。我的 HTML 代码使用小写 .jpg
引用了所有图像。
我正在 Synology DS 上运行网络服务器。
【讨论】:
【参考方案4】:我昨晚刚开始写 html,所以这是一个完全的菜鸟响应,因为我刚刚遇到了同样的问题,但是如果你在 Windows 计算机上,那么你在文件位置的斜杠应该是反斜杠而不是正斜杠 就像我说的 - 完全是菜鸟,但希望它有所帮助
【讨论】:
【参考方案5】:确保您在正确的子域中,以防您使用 dev、staging 等。
我也想知道,直到我发现我在图像不存在的暂存域中。
还要确保清除缓存。
【讨论】:
【参考方案6】:如果您尝试不同的方法但都不起作用,只需将图像文件移动到 HTML 文件所在的工作文件夹即可。
以下作品:
<img src="me.jpg" >
【讨论】:
【参考方案7】:如果您使用的是百里香叶,请注意。那么你必须有像这样的源:(它本身会通过并且不采用存储库路径,...)。
<div id="upperPart">
<img id="foxPicture" th:src="greenfox.png" />
<a class="Mr.Fox_description">This is Mr. Fox. Currently living on pizza and lemonade. He knows 2 tricks. </a>
</div>
【讨论】:
【参考方案8】:我已经解决了我的问题,将src="image.jpg"
替换为src="file:///c:\FULL_PATH\image.jpg"
【讨论】:
【参考方案9】: 列表项-
只需转到驱动器上的图像位置
选择图片
使用您喜欢的浏览器打开它
转到网址栏
从网址栏中复制位置
在img src=(粘贴到这里)中使用它
看起来像这样
img src="file:///C:/Users/Mercy/Documents/WEB%20DEVELOPMENT/HTML5/lion.jpg" 李>
【讨论】:
以上是关于HTML <img src> 不会加载我的图片的主要内容,如果未能解决你的问题,请参考以下文章
<v-img> 不适用于静态图像。 [Vuetify] 图片加载失败 src:@/assets/img/logo.png